Geelong absolutely love playing Port Adelaide and the recent history is hard to ignore.
The Cats have won their last three meetings against the Power by 88, 76 and 84 points, two of those were at Adelaide Oval. Port showed more spirit against Hawthorn last week but remain a much weaker team than the last few years. They have been gifted an easy draw too, having faced last year’s bottom four plus St Kilda and Hawthorn. This is their biggest test yet and they arrive with serious question marks.
Geelong have flexed their muscles over the last fortnight, smashing West Coast by 46 and the Dogs by 75. Their draw has been far tougher, having faced the second, third, fourth, seventh and tenth-placed teams plus West Coast. Their form has been underestimated and look ready to pile on some pain against lesser teams in the coming weeks.
The Cats have also covered in five straight at Adelaide Oval. This could get ugly.

Shannon Neale is averaging 2.2 goals per game this season and Port are thin for key defenders beyond Aliir Aliir.
Bailey Smith continues to stuff the stat sheet, averaging 34.2 disposals in his last five games and recording 30 in each of his last two against Port.
Max Holmes has had 25 or more disposals in eight straight games.
